netfilter: xt_u32: reject invalid shift counts
u32_match_it() executes rule-supplied shift operands on a 32-bit
value. A malformed u32 rule can provide a shift count of 32 or more,
triggering an undefined shift out-of-bounds during packet evaluation.
Validate XT_U32_LEFTSH and XT_U32_RIGHTSH operands in
u32_mt_checkentry() and reject malformed rules before they reach the
packet path.
